About Paul

Paul Jacobs is a Licensed Master Social Worker with 10 years of mental health experience spanning schools, hospitals, athletics, and private practice. He specializes in assisting adolescents and adults struggling with depression, anxiety, and trauma. Paul welcomes clients of all cultures, races, ethnicities, genders, identities, and abilities, recognizing that every person has a unique narrative. He believes mental health is a fundamental aspect of overall well-being and should be accessible to everyone.


Paul has a Master of Social Work in Interpersonal Practice from the University of Michigan. He carefully adjusts his treatment to his clients' needs and may use approaches such as cognitive behavioral therapy, cognitive reprocessing therapy, prolonged exposure therapy, motivational interviewing, and mindfulness techniques.


Paul prioritizes cultivating a nonjudgmental, open-minded, and genuinely authentic atmosphere where individuals can bring their distinct blend of values, beliefs, culture, and experiences.
